What You’ll Do Each Day

As a part-time remote sales representative, your primary focus is connecting with potential clients. You’ll present the company’s products and services using various communication channels.

Managing your schedule offers the chance to balance other commitments while boosting your earnings. Your performance truly dictates your income due to uncapped commissions.

Utilize provided training resources to polish your selling techniques and keep your product knowledge current. You will build trust, handle objections, and close sales with confidence.

Successfully onboarding customers and offering post-sale support is another component of the role, ensuring a pleasant client experience every time.

Periodic meetings with the remote team help you stay updated and motivated, offering growth and feedback opportunities to further your career.

Job Pros: Flexibility and Training

Remote work is a major advantage, allowing you to plan your day as you see fit. You’ll never miss important life events or commitments.

The uncapped earning potential stands out as a compelling benefit for driven individuals seeking to maximize their income based on effort, not hours.

Job Cons: Self-motivation Needed

Working from home demands discipline. Those who thrive on external supervision may find it harder to stay motivated and organized without in-person accountability.

Income can vary until you develop a strong client base or sales rhythm. For those new to sales, growing your earnings might take extra time and persistence.
